Ally McCoist rinses Celtic over celebrations after Rangers win as Chris Sutton hits back with brutal put down

Ally McCoist refused to take the bait of TV sparring partner Chris Sutton as he took a cheeky dig at Celtic 's derby day celebration.

The Rangers legend wasn't having the post-match party atmosphere at Celtic Park as Ange Postecoglou 's side battered the champions.

After watching his former side earn bragging rights, Sutton was keen to wind up on BT Sport's Scottish Football Extra.

But McCoist brushed it aside insisting that the players and fans had to calm down.

Sutton said: “I can’t remember the last time Ally got absolutely pumped but his team got pumped. Absolutely blown away by Celtic.

“Celtic back on top. You only have to look at the possession stats, Celtic top of those and the Celtic ball boys second. Where were the Rangers?”

McCoist hit back: “It was three points lads. It was three points.

“I didn’t know you also won the Calcutta Cup, the Super Bowl, the Ryder Cup.

“There’s over the top celebrations but how about that?"

But Sutton wasn't having any of it, clapping back: "What a sore loser!"

McCoist went on: “I got a complaint from one of my Celtic supporting mates in the village because big Ange never shook his hand after the game.

“They were shaking hands with the crowd, gee whiz lads. Calm down.”
